Every town has its secrets. Some are too deadly to stay hidden.
Chouteau County's super-rich know how to cover up a scandal, but
when it comes to murder, they'd better watch their backs . . .
Death investigator Angela Richman is determined to see a killer
brought to justice in this sharply written and darkly entertaining
mystery set in Missouri, perfect for fans of Lisa Gardner and J.A.
Jance. Angela Richman, Chouteau County death investigator, finds
herself deep in the Missouri woods on a perfect spring day. But
there is nothing idyllic about her grim walk - a body has been
discovered in a muddy creek, and Detective Jace Budewitz wants
Angela on the scene. Terri Gibbons, the popular Forest High track
star who went missing eight months ago, has been found strangled.
Could a message found in Terri's shoe hold the key to catching her
killer? Chouteau Forest is a town of privilege and secrets, where
everyone has something to hide . . . Can Angela overcome the many
obstacles in her way to see justice served when the Forest's
wealthy residents will go to any lengths to prevent the truth being
revealed?
Hollywood diva Jessica Gray is on the last leg of her one-woman
show when she suffers a sudden and fatal illness . . . but Angela
Richman thinks there's more to it. "Ageless" Hollywood diva Jessica
Gray is finishing the last leg of her one-woman show in St Louis,
Missouri, and the nearby town of Chouteau Forest is dazzled. During
the show she humiliates three homeless women onstage, fires her
entourage - not for the first time - and makes a bitter enemy of
the town's powerful patriarch. After she collapses at an after-show
party and is rushed to the hospital, she ignores the advice of her
doctors and discharges herself in order to return to LA. On the way
to the airport she suffers a deadly coughing fit. It was poison.
When Angela Richman's friend, Mario, is arrested for the murder and
faces the death penalty, she is compelled to investigate. With so
many grudges held against the actress and Mario's life on the line,
the stakes are higher than ever.

When Angela Richman finds two dead bodies in a cursed crypt on
Halloween, she is drawn into a spine-tingling mystery. Has a
Chouteau Forest legend turned deadly, or is a dangerous killer on
the loose? Everyone in Chouteau Forest knows the legend of the
Cursed Crypt. It's claimed that the restless spirit of a professor
nicknamed Mean Gene Cortini, buried in Chouteau Forest University's
crypt, has been causing death and destruction in the Forest for
almost two centuries. Local residents are used to disease and
natural disasters striking every seven years. But not murder. When
Trey Lawson outbids the wealthy Du Pres family at the university's
annual Howl-o-ween Benefit Auction, he wins the chance to spend the
night in the crypt with his fiancee, Lydia. Angela Richman, Death
Investigator, finds their mutilated bodies there the following
morning. As Angela investigates, she learns that Trey was
threatening the established hierarchy of Chouteau Forest. Has the
legend taken a deadly turn, or are Trey and Lydia victims of a
vicious power struggle?
Death Investigator Angela Richman suspects foul play when a
disgraced resident of Chouteau Forest survives one car crash only
to then be involved in another. Until his Porsche careened off the
road killing him instantly and not leaving much of him behind,
Sterling Chaney was an influential member of Chouteau Forest - home
of the one percenters. As the eulogies at his funeral commence, an
unexpected guest interrupts . . . Sterling. The story attracts
widespread media coverage. Sterling's the man who showed up late
for his own funeral. He revels in the spotlight, until it's
revealed he earned his fortune via sordid means and exploiting the
women who worked for him. It leaves him vilified and shunned by
Chouteau society. Then there's another fatal crash. This time,
Death Investigator Angela Richman is tasked with confirming that
Sterling has perished. But her investigation reveals more questions
than answers. Were both crashes merely accidents, or was someone
doubly determined to kill Sterling?
Fans of J.A. Jance and Lisa Gardner will love this exploration of
the little-known job of death investigator in small-town Missouri
where Angela Richman finds herself investigating the lives and
secrets of the one percenters in Chouteau Forest. Chouteau Forest's
wealthy are being targeted by the Ghost Burglars, who've carried
out twelve burglaries over two weeks. So far, there's been no
bloodshed . . . until Tom Lockridge is brutally slain inside his
marble mansion during the latest raid. Angela Richman, death
investigator for Chouteau County, is called to assess the scene and
the body by Detective Jace Budewitz. As they investigate, Jace
becomes obsessed with proving the Ghost Burglars weren't involved
in the murder. Can the burglars be ruled out so easily? Is there
more to Cynthia Lockridge, Tom's wife, seeking solace in the arms
of the ambitious local lawyer Wesley Desloge? What about Tom's
long-suffering daughter, or his loose-lipped housekeeper or office
manager? Everyone is keeping secrets, but whose erupted into
violence that fateful night?

The last thing Chouteau County death investigator Angela Richman
wants to do during the holidays is her job. So it's with some
trepidation that she agrees to help the desperate Mr. and Mrs.
LaRouche when they show up on her doorstep. Their daughter Juliet
is missing. She was last seen leaving a high school party just
before midnight, and they'd like Angela's help getting their
trusted local detectives involved. The officer assigned to the
case—Chouteau newcomer Det. Jace Budewitz—is far too blunt and
impolite for their liking. And with the weather murderously cold,
they can't bear the thought that their little princess is in the
harsh winter wilderness. Discreetly investigating Juliet's
disappearance, Angela finds herself struggling to break through the
silence from the rich teenagers who knew Juliet and their
infuriatingly detached parents. She also discovers that their
vicious bias against the local working class has cast a shadow over
the case. The more she digs, the less Angela can comprehend the
lengths the one percent will go to protect their own. Angela must
work quickly as she searches for answers with the acute awareness
that Juliet LaRouche edges closer to becoming just a memory…
